Zodiac Animals: Each animal, from the rat to the pig, represents a year in the 12-year lunar cycle. 2025 is the Year of the Snake, a symbol of wisdom and mystery. Red and Gold Colors: These colors dominate the Lunar New Year celebrations as they symbolize good luck and prosperity. Chinese New Year Printables About Chinese New Year. The Chinese New Year is the most important traditional Chinese holiday. In China, it is known as the Spring Festival and marks the end of the winter season. The festival begins on the first day of the new lunisolar year and ends with the Lantern Festival on the fifteenth day. With the changing of the new year of the lunar calendar, the Chinese believe each year to represent one of the twelve Chinese zodiac animals. The twelve animals include the rat, ox, tiger, rabbit, dragon, snake, horse, goat, monkey, rooster, dog, and pig. Free Bilingual Lunar New Year Coloring Pages. Chinese New Year is the biggest and most important holiday of the year for Chinese people around the world. It is actually two celebrations in one. According to Chinese tradition, everyone’s birthday is celebrated on New Year’s Day. This is also the most important time of the year for families to get together. 2.
